2011-12-28 11:39 AM in reply to: #3957733 |
Elite 7783 PEI, Canada | Subject: RE: Anyone know HTML OK? Q re HTML table in training log TriAya - 2011-12-28 1:30 PM For some reason, the silly background image manatee will not show up ... In the code that ends up in your blog there are some < b > and < /b > tags on either side of the link to the manatee image. ie. background-image: url< b >< /b >('http://farm8.staticflickr.com/7023/6584534955_eca6914a51_o.jpg'< b >< /b > Firefox reports that it can't parse that so it drops it. Try removing those. |
